Transaction 6750f7b26fce65d80e66714ed54f9d9e27e93770d2a60264e5c4da8a22f60d33
1 Input
1 Output
-
6750f7b26fce65d80e66714ed54f9d9e27e93770d2a60264e5c4da8a22f60d33:0
- value
- 38195319
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a0753a4cedf8a649ee47bff8ea619b476fabd6c OP_EQUAL
- address
- 38SShoufNXksUHQe8DLm7gfF9VqM5ZDrHk